Area Prep Softball Report for Saturday, April 24

The season came to an end for No. 7 Academy of Our Lady Friday as the Penguins fell to No. 2 seed St. Thomas More 12-2 in the Division II quarterfinals in Lafayette.

St. Thomas More will take on No. 3 Haynes Academy in the semifinals.

Coming off of a 21-9 upset win on the road at No. 7 Eunice, Belle Chasse seeks a second upset, an even bigger one, at home against Beau Chene Saturday at 4:30 p.m. in the Class 4A quarterfinals.
